Librairie Spice avec LTSpice ex : LM358

Forum sur les logiciels de simulation SPICE

Modérateur : Modérateur

JP
Administrateur
Administrateur
Messages : 2323
Inscription : 23 sept. 2003 18:14
Localisation : Strasbourg
Contact :

Librairie Spice avec LTSpice ex : LM358

Message par JP »

Hello,

Je viens de chercher comment utiliser une librairie standard spice dans LTSpice, donc si quelqu'un se pose la question voilà comment faire :
  1. Récupérer le fichier spice : http://www.national.com/models/spice/LM/LM358.MOD et le mettre dans le même répertoire que votre schéma.
  2. Ajouter un symbole standard d'AOP comme opamp2 qui se trouve dans \lib\sym\Opamps\
  3. Editer le fichier spice :

    Code : Tout sélectionner

    .SUBCKT LM358/NS    1   2  99  50  28
    LM358/NS est le nom qu'il faudra utiliser pour votre AOP.
  4. Cliquer avec le bouton droit de souris sur Opamp2 et dans value mettez LM358/NS
  5. Edit -> Spice directive :

    Code : Tout sélectionner

    .include LM358_NS.MOD
Si vous devez créer un symbole :
  1. File -> New Symbol
  2. Dessinez votre composant avec les outils du menu Draw.
  3. Pour rajouter les pattes Edit->Add Pin/port

    Code : Tout sélectionner

    * connections:      non-inverting input
    *                   |   inverting input
    *                   |   |   positive power supply
    *                   |   |   |   negative power supply
    *                   |   |   |   |   output
    *                   |   |   |   |   |
    *                   |   |   |   |   |
    .SUBCKT LM358/NS    1   2  99  50  28
    Position 1 : 1 entrée +
    Position 2 : 2 entrée -
    Position 3 : 99 V+
    etc

    Respectez cette ordre, l'entrée + de votre symbole devra avoir la valeur "Netlist Order" 1, l'entrée V+ la valeur "Netlist Order" 3.
a+
JP
Ca clignote !!!!

Invité

Message par Invité »

Bonsoir,

Pouvez vous reprendre depuis le début pcq j'ai rien compris. Ltspice ne lit pas le fichiers *.MOD En plus je perd le fil dans les pt 4 et 5. Je ne vois pas de "value" et pas "spice directive"

Merci

JP
Administrateur
Administrateur
Messages : 2323
Inscription : 23 sept. 2003 18:14
Localisation : Strasbourg
Contact :

Message par JP »

Bonjour,
Ltspice ne lit pas le fichiers *.MOD
Je n'ai pas dis qu'il fallait ouvrir le fichier .mod mais le mettre dans le même répertoire que le schéma :
Récupérer le fichier spice : http://www.national.com/models/spice/LM/LM358.MOD et le mettre dans le même répertoire que votre schéma.
En plus je perd le fil dans les pt 4 et 5. Je ne vois pas de "value" et pas "spice directive"
pt4 a écrit :Cliquer avec le bouton droit de souris sur Opamp2 et dans value mettez LM358/NS

Il faut insérer un composant nommé "Opamp2", une fois dans le schéma il faut cliquer avec le bouton droit de la souris dessus et remplir le champ "value" avec LM358/NS.
pt5 a écrit :Edit -> Spice directive :
Dans le menu Edit de LTspice, il faut cliquer sur Spice directive.

J'espere que c'est plus clair.
a+
JP
Ca clignote !!!!

Invité

Message par Invité »

Merci j'ai compris la méthode j'étais allé sur le LTspice puis "New symbol" dans "File" ça ne pouvais pas trop marcher.

Merci encore de votre aide.

Répondre